I have the following code (just as a test) and I want to create an HTTP proxy using EventMachine. The code below is an example on the es-proxy GitHub page. However, when I run this and open up a website that has a moderate amount of images, the images start loading incorrectly. What I mean by this is that some images are loaded twice or if I request my icon for the navigation bar, I instead get the profile picture. This is especially evident if I refresh the page a few times.
It seems that the responses do not correspond to the matching request; causing everything to be jumbled. However, I'm not sure why this is. The code below seems simple enough for this to not be a problem.
require 'rubygems'
require 'em-proxy'
require 'http/parser' # gem install http_parser.rb
require 'uuid' # gem install uuid
# > ruby em-proxy-http.rb
# > curl --proxy localhost:9889 www.google.com
host = "0.0.0.0"
port = 9889
puts "listening on #{host}:#{port}..."
Proxy.start(:host => host, :port => port) do |conn|
@p = Http::Parser.new
@p.on_headers_complete = proc do |h|
session = UUID.generate
puts "New session: #{session} (#{h.inspect})"
host, port = h['Host'].split(':')
conn.server session, :host => host, :port => (port || 80)
conn.relay_to_servers @buffer
@buffer = ''
end
@buffer = ''
conn.on_connect do |data,b|
puts [:on_connect, data, b].inspect
end
conn.on_data do |data|
@buffer << data
@p << data
data
end
conn.on_response do |backend, resp|
#puts [:on_response, backend, resp].inspect
resp
end
conn.on_finish do |backend, name|
puts [:on_finish, name].inspect
end
end
Update
I believe I have insight as to what is happening but, still no way of solving my problem. I am creating a server for each request and when I relay my requests I have multiple servers. Then in the on response I should only be returning the response if it is from the correct server. However, I don't have a way to correlate this as of yet.
